Sinclair is Honored to Continue to Award Scholarships to High Achieving Students Seeking Careers in Media

 

Since 2013, Sinclair's annual scholarship program has provided $431,414 in tuition assistance. The scholarship program aims to invest in the future of the broadcast industry by helping students complete their education and pursue careers in journalism and marketing. The Fund plans to award scholarships of up to $5,000.

Applicants must be a current college sophomore or junior at an accredited four-year undergraduate college or university in the United States. Students from anywhere in the US may apply.

  • The deadline for submission is April 30, 2026.

Description

You will need to provide the following information and materials in English:

  • Contact information

  • Education information

  • Qualification for financial aid

  • Cover letter (must explain personal background, financial need, and career goals in 300 words or fewer)

  • Detailed answer to one of two specific questions related to fields of journalism / marketing.

  • Two (2) work samples (such as articles, video/audio clips, photos, personal website, or other relevant project)

  • Resume

  • Unofficial college transcript.

Qualifications

To be eligible for the Sinclair Scholarship, an applicant must be:

  • A U.S. citizen

  • A current college sophomore or junior at a four-year undergraduate college or university (scholarships will be applied to applicant’s junior or senior year, respectively)

  • Pursuing careers in journalism or marketing

  • Carrying a minimum 2.50 cumulative GPA (or its equivalent) at the time of application.

An applicant may not:

  • Be a full-time employee, or be related to any employee, officer or board member of Sinclair, Inc., or any of its subsidiaries (“Sinclair”).

Sinclair, Inc. (Nasdaq: SBGI) is a diversified media company and a leading provider of local news and sports. The Company owns, operates and/or provides services to 185 television stations in 86 markets affiliated with all the major broadcast networks; owns Tennis Channel and multicast networks Comet, CHARGE!, TBD., and The Nest. Sinclair’s content is delivered via multiple platforms, including over-the-air, multi-channel video program distributors, and the nation’s largest streaming aggregator of local news content, NewsON.
